Rex Randall

Rex Randall was a fictional character in the UK soap opera Family Affairs, played by John Hopkins from November to December 2005 when the series ended. Rex arrived in Charnham in November 2005, as the new owner of The Black Swan, which was later renamed The Phoenix.
